To determine

Identify the criteria which determine whether the investor should apply the equity method of accounting to this investment or not.

The criteria for determining whether the investor should apply the equity method of accounting to this investment or not is as follows:

  • The investor should invest at least 20% or it should acquire at least 20% of the investee’s share.
  • The investor should be able to exercise the significant influence over the investee.

If the above two conditions are fulfilled then the organization can use the equity method.
